Primary programming and algorithms
August 5th, 15:00-16:30
Programming and algorithms are fundamental to the primary computing curriculum. During this CPD, you will discover engaging and effective ways to help children use computational thinking. You’ll help them develop their knowledge of how technology works, and the skills to make computers follow instructions through simple programs. A range of approaches will be explored, including ‘unplugged’ activities that require no computer. You’ll also gain confidence in leading programming and multimedia activities that allow creativity and promote widespread engagement. The professional development will highlight the differences and commonalities across Key Stages 1 and 2, helping all primary teachers to plan for age-appropriate learning while developing an understanding of progression through computing.
